White Star Line, RMS Titanic, A La Carte Restaurant

White Star Line, RMS Titanic. Rare A La Carte Restaurant flyer from a promotional brochure, owned by Second Class passenger Joseph Laroche of Haiti who died in the sinking. However this item stayed at home in France and was subsequently given by Louise Laroche, Joseph?s daughter who survived the sinking, to the vendor. 5ins. 4ins. Date: 1910s

This 5 inch by 4 inch vintage flyer showcases the exquisite A La Carte Restaurant aboard the White Star Line's RMS Titanic. Dated back to the 1910s, this rare promotional item was once owned by Joseph Laroche, a Second Class passenger from Haiti who tragically perished in the Titanic's sinking. Remarkably, this precious memento remained in France and was later passed down to Louise Laroche, Joseph's surviving daughter. The A La Carte Restaurant, with its promise of "Catering to Your Every Wish," epitomized the luxurious experience aboard the Titanic, a ship of unparalleled elegance and sophistication.
